Adverbs are words that modify or describe verbs, adjectives, or other adverbs, providing more information about the action or situation. They can express manner (e.g., "she sings beautifully"), time (e.g., "I'll finish soon"), place (e.g., "he's coming over"), or degree (e.g., "it's very hot"). By adding adverbs to sentences, speakers can convey subtle shades of meaning, making communication more precise and engaging.

The primary purpose of an adverb is to provide additional details about the action or situation being described. By doing so, adverbs help to create a clearer image in the listener's or reader's mind.
